R.I.P. Normand Corbeil. ‘Heavy Rain’, ‘Indigo Prophecy’ Composer Dies At Age 56

Sad news has struck the video game world as Heavy Rain and Indigo Prophecy composer Normand Corbiel has passed away at age 56, losing his battle with pancreatic cancer this past Friday. His son posted the news via The Cancer Forum.

The BAFTA-award winning composer was working on Quantic Dream’s upcoming game Beyond: Two Souls. It is unclear if he finished his work.

E3 2012: Heavy Rain Dev Announces ‘Beyond: Two Souls’ With A Stunning Debut Trailer

The makers of the fantastic cinematic thriller Heavy Rain have been hard at work on a secret game that was unveiled at E3 earlier today. It’s called Beyond: Two Souls, and don’t let its awful title fool you–this game looks incredible. It’s a psychological action thriller starring a young woman who has rather remarkable powers given to her by an invisible entity.
